Summary

Everything you need to know about AI to survive—and thrive—as an engineer.

If you’re worried about your tech career going obsolete in a world of super-powered AI, never fear. The AI Pocket Book crams everything engineers need to know about AI into one short volume you can fit into your pocket. You’ll build a better understanding of AI (and its limitations), learn how to use it more effectively, and future-proof your job against its advancement.

In The AI Pocket Book you’ll find no-nonsense advice on:

• Deciphering AI jargon (there’s lots of it!)
• Where AI fits within your field of engineering
• Why AI hallucinates—and what to do about it
• What to do when AI comes for your job
• The dark side of AI—copyright, snake oil, and replacing humans
• Balancing skepticism with unrealistic expectations

The AI Pocket Book gives you Emmanuel Maggiori’s unvarnished and opinionated take on where AI can be useful, and where it still kind of sucks. Whatever your tech field, this short-and-sweet guide delivers the facts and techniques you’ll need in the workplace of the present.

About the book

The AI Pocket Book takes a peek inside the AI black box and gives you just enough on key topics like transformers, hallucinations, and the modern ecosystem of AI models and tools. You’ll get handy techniques to select AI tools, learn when putting AI first is the smart move, and pick up some excellent tips for managing the inevitable, potentially expensive, screw ups.

What's inside

• Deciphering AI jargon (there’s lots of it!)
• Evaluating AI tools
• Why AI hallucinates and what to do about it
• How and when to use AI

About the reader

For engineers in all fields, from software to security.

About the author

Emmanuel Maggiori, PhD, is a software engineer and 10-year AI industry insider. He is also the author of Smart Until It’s Dumb and Siliconned.

Table of Contents

1 How AI works
2 Hallucinations
3 Selecting and evaluating AI tools
4 When to use (and not to use) AI
5 How AI will affect jobs and how to stay ahead
6 The fine print

Author Biography

Emmanuel Maggiori, PhD, is a 10-year AI industry insider who specializes in machine learning and scientific computing. He has developed AI for everything from processing satellite images to packaging deals for holiday travelers. Emmanuel Maggiori is the author of Smart Until It's Dumb and Siliconned.
